A small-sized, semi-terrestrial, evergreen orchid. Three to five, oval-elliptic leaves are leathery, dull, dark green mottled with pale green, with purple spots below. The leaves are up to 14cm long and 2-3cm wide. Solitary flowers up to 10cm across are large compared to the size of plants. Terminal flowering stems up to 25cm long emerge from the centre of the leaf rosettes in spring and summer. Characteristic, inflated lip is round, larger than petals and sepals, usually white or pale pink. Petals and upper sepals are pale green and pink with darker tesselated pattern.
